Да, пунктуация корректна.
Лучше: В связи с большим объемом работ необходимо привлечь Сафонова С. В. к обслуживанию и установке АТС.
Пунктуация зависит от конкретного контекста.
В школьной грамматике числительные разделяются на четыре лексико-грамматических разряда: количественные числительные (пять, сто сорок четыре), порядковые (седьмой, двадцать второй), собирательные (двое, семеро), дробные (две трети, три четвертых).
В грамматическом отношении ярким своеобразием отличаются прежде всего количественные и собирательные числительные. На этом основании в научной грамматике в состав числительного часто вводят только эти два разряда числительных. Дробные числительные вообще не выделяют в качестве самостоятельного разряда, а порядковые числительные относят к другой части речи — прилагательным, поскольку грамматические свойства порядковых прилагательных совпадают с грамматическими свойствами прилагательных.
При таком подходе так называемые дробные числительные рассматриваются как сочетания слов (часто с союзом и), имеющие числовое или количественное значение и относящиеся к разным частям речи (две трети, одна вторая, шесть седьмых, одна целая пять десятых, четыре целых и двадцать пять сотых и т. п.). Две трети представляет собой сочетание количественного числительного и существительного.
Подобные случаи в справочниках не приведены, но очевидно, что причастный оборот не однороден количественному числительному, а потому запятая не ставится.
Поскольку прямая речь заканчивается вопросительным знаком, точка после кавычек не ставится.
Если следовать "букве закона", то есть формальным правилам, то научился в Вашем предложении - часть составного глагольного сказуемого с модальным значением. Вот почему:
http://www.gramota.ru/book/litnevskaya.php?part5.htm#31202
Приинфинитивная часть составного глагольного сказуемого выражает грамматическое значение сказуемого, а также дополнительную характеристику действия — указание на его начало, середину или конец (фазисное значение) или возможность, желательность, степень обычности и другие характеристики, описывающие отношение субъекта действия к этому действию (модальное значение).
Фазисное значение выражается глаголами стать, начать (начинать), приняться (приниматься), продолжить (продолжать), перестать (переставать), прекратить (прекращать) и некоторыми другими (чаще всего это синонимы к приведенным словам, характерные для разговорного стиля речи):
Я начал / продолжил / закончил читать эту книгу.
Модальное значение может выражаться
1) глаголами уметь, мочь, хотеть, желать, стараться, намереваться, осмелиться, отказаться, думать, предпочитать, привыкнуть, любить, ненавидеть, остерегаться и Т. п.
2) глаголом-связкой быть (в наст. времени в нулевой форме) + краткими прилагательными рад, готов, обязан, должен, намерен, способен, а также наречиями и существительными с модальным значением:
Я был готов / не прочь / в состоянии подождать.
Не являются составными глагольными сказуемые, выраженные:
1) составной формой будущего времени глагола несовершенного вида в изъявительном наклонении: Я завтра буду работать;
2) сочетанием простого глагольного сказуемого с инфинитивом, занимающим в предложении позицию дополнения в случае разных субъектов действия у спрягаемой формы глагола и инфинитива: Все просили ее спеть (все просили, а спеть должна она);
3) сочетанием простого глагольного сказуемого с инфинитивом, который в предложении является обстоятельством цели: Он вышел на улицу погулять.
Нетрудно заметить, что во всех этих случаях спрягаемая форма глагола, стоящая перед инфинитивом, не имеет ни фазисного, ни модального значения.
Да, пример аналогичен случаям из параграфа 8 полного академического справочника «Правила русской орфографии и пунктуации» под ред. В. В. Лопатина (М., 2006 и след.), особенно случаю из пункта а): Жить бы да жить вам, молодым… а вас… как этих… угорелых по свету носит... (здесь также изображена ситуация поиска точного слова в ходе произнесения предложения).
В итоге вот что получается (далее о цитатах, но то же самое относится и к прямой речи): 76">http://gramota.ru/spravka/letters/?rub=rubric76